About Us

Virtually connecting older adults, especially those living with cognitive decline, with young adult college students to combat the epidemic of social isolation and loneliness. Putting a smile on the faces of older adults and creating a bridge between them and youth. Virtual volunteering and awareness events, to name a few, can achieve this mission.

Members Benefits

First and foremost, this club provides the opportunity to gain meaningful volunteering experience with older adults, potentially strengthening a resume. Additionally, this organization offers a great deal of flexibility, and the ability to accommodate every individual's needs and schedules. Most importantly, this club can help strengthen interpersonal skills and develop necessary communication skills for job markets and professional settings. Lastly, being a part of this club contributes to the community by playing an active role in decreasing older adult isolation and loneliness.
